Subject: [PATCH] t5562: chunked sleep to avoid lost SIGCHILD

If was found during stress-test run that a test may hang by 60 seconds.
It supposedly happens because SIGCHILD was received before sleep has
started.
Fix by looping by smaller chunks, checking $exited after each of them.
Then lost SIGCHILD would not cause longer delay than 1 second.

t/t5562/invoke-with-content-length.pl | 7 ++++++-
1 file changed, 6 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/t/t5562/invoke-with-content-length.pl b/t/t5562/invoke-with-content-length.pl
index 0943474af2..257e280e3b 100644
--- a/t/t5562/invoke-with-content-length.pl
+++ b/t/t5562/invoke-with-content-length.pl
@@ -29,7 +29,12 @@
}
print $out $body_data or die "Cannot write data: $!";
-sleep 60; # is interrupted by SIGCHLD
+my $counter = 0;
+while (not $exited and $counter < 60) {
+ sleep 1;
+ $counter = $counter + 1;
+}
+
if (!$exited) {
close($out);
die "Command did not exit after reading whole body";
